When you are negotiating the price of real estate, it is best to have a moderate approach. A lot of people adopt an aggressive attitude in the hope that the other party will cave. This is not the best way to proceed. Set your limits and stick to them, but your agent or lawyer have more experience in handling these kinds of negotiations.

Properties that require major improvements are usually sold at a lower price. This permits you to save your money on the purchase price, and you have time to work on your home at your own pace. You can use the money you saved to improve the home in a way that truly suits you. At the same time those improvements will likewise increase the value of your home. Focus on the positive aspects of a home, while still being realistic about what it will cost to make necessary improvements. Look beyond minor imperfections, to see the home you have always dreamed of.

Buying commercial property can be easier if you have a partner that you can trust. When you have a partner who has a good financial standing and reputation, it is much easier to quality for the loan needed to purchase the property. Investing with a partner helps to reduce the cost you will have to pay for a down payment, and it can increase your chances of being approved when applying for a large commercial loan.

If you make an offer and the seller doesn’t accept it, there’s always room for negotiation. The seller might be able to reduce the price, repair things or share the closing cost.
